Bengaluru: Mangaluru-headquartered private lender the Karnataka Bank has posted a net profit of Rs 146 crore for the quarter ended December, recording year-on-year growth of 8.16 per cent as against Rs 135.37 crores of net profit earned during the same period last year.

The asset quality also improved significantly as gross NPA declined by 39 basis points to 4.11 per cent from 4.50 per cent compared to the quarter ended September, the bank said in a press release.

The bank has clocked a business turnover of Rs 1,33,918 crore as at the end of December, growing 5.44 per cent year-on-year. While deposits recorded a year-on-year growth of 6.24 per cent, advances grew by 4.33 per cent.


Bank’s MD & CEO Mahabaleshwara MS said: “This has been one more quarter of consistent and satisfactory performance without any negative surprises. Despite the adverse effect of the pandemic on the economy, the stress in credit portfolio is receding as could be seen by the reduction in gross NPA…I am very happy that all the Transformation driven initiatives have started yielding the desired result.”
